Job purpose

As a Pricing Specialist you ensure customer agreements are correctly reflected in the P&L and help convert commercial agreements into real cash. You support the Out of Home & Food Service business in the Netherlands by following up on financial engagements and ensuring customer invoices are processed correctly. You are the key contact for the sales community regarding commitments and financial reserves.


What will your main responsibilities be?

  • Ensure customer invoices are processed accurately and swiftly (yourself or by guiding remote teams);
  • Advise Sales and Finance on P&L risks and opportunities;
  • Ensure audit and control guidelines are fully respected for pricing-related matters;
  • Act as the link between outsourced services and the sales community;
  • Provide clear updates on customers’ payment position;
  • Continuously identify process improvements and automation opportunities.
